NMRRC 2015 Round 5

What a mental weekend!

The pace was so fast! My personal best laptime this weekend of 53.6 would have put me pole last year, this year it was only good enough for 10th!

Race 1 was a bit of a disaster, terrible start and crashing on lap 1 trying to make up for lost time. I managed to work my way back up to 14th.

if you tune them you will race in open, against bikes kicking out 30bhp - I would just stick to stock class.

140 or 160 are both stock classes.

I race in 140 and the competition is unreal - so close, I race in class B cos I lap Whilton in 58-59 seconds, so far enough of the top lads to not qualify for class A.

Even though, class B is equally tight - it's fantastic fun.

there arn't many places that let you on to be honest - biggest practice night is tuesday night at Whilton (the track in this vid)

there are others,

stretton lets us on pretty much anytime, and I've heard FATCATs sometimes let us on on quiet days, but have set bike nights too
